南水北调中线陕西水源区生态补偿量模型研究

摘    要:在跨流域生态共建共享补偿机制中,生态补偿量的计算是工作的重点和难点,是确定补偿水源区多少的关键,补偿标准确定方法的合理性直接关系着机制的顺利实施.选择南水北调中线陕西水源区为研究对象,构建生态补偿量计算模型.从水源区保护水源所付出的成本、受水区经济可承受能力、水源区的水资源价值和环境容量排污权的损失价值4种途径计算陕西水源区水土保持生态补偿量.通过4种途径计算结果比较分析,认为基于水源区保护水源所付出成本的水源区生态服务补偿支付较为可行.陕西水源区的生态补偿量生态环境建设期为99.56亿元/年,生态环境管护期为90.86亿元/年,同时,根据受水区所需水质标准对所推荐的补偿标准进行修正,为建立跨流域调水水土保持生态补偿机制提供了有益参考.

关 键 词:水土保持  生态补偿量  陕西水源区

Study on Calculation Model of Eco-compensation Quantity in Shaanxi Water Source of Middle Line South-to-North Water Transfer Project

Abstract:The calculation of eco-compensation quantity is not only the key approach in confirming the eco-compensation, but also the emphasis and difficulty in constructing and sharing the eco-compensation mechanism of the inter-basin area. The rationality of the compensation standard confirming method has a direct relation to the well practice of the mechanism. Taken Shaanxi water source area of the Middle Line South-to-North Water Transfer project as the study object, the calculation model of soil and water conservation eco-compensation quantity was build. Through the following four methods, such as the devotion of ecological and environmental construction and management in water source areas, the enduring water resources cost capacity in intake areas, water resources value and the loss value of environmental capacity use right, the soil and water conservation eco-compensation quantity of Shaanxi water source areas was calculated. The calculation result was also analyzed. It is recommended that the soil and water conservation eco-compensation quantity of Shaanxi water source areas was 9. 956 billion Yuan per year during ecological environmental construction period, and 9. 086 billion Yuan per year during ecological environmental management period. Then based on the water quality standard intake areas needed, the eco-compensation quantity was revised, which provided some helpful reference in establishing the soil and water conservation eco-compensation mechanism on inter-basin water transfer.
